Kantooradres

Overvliet 25 - 3545 NG Utrecht

Telefoonnummers

+31 (0)30 - 899 3767

E-mailadressen

info@rutron.nl

Systeemontwerp

Systeemontwerp

Bij Rutron B.V. begrijpen we dat een robuust en efficiënt systeemontwerp cruciaal is voor het succes van elke IT-infrastructuur. Onze Systeemontwerpdiensten bieden een uitgebreide aanpak voor het ontwerpen en implementeren van systemen die voldoen aan uw unieke bedrijfsbehoeften. Wij geloven dat een goed geavanceerd systeem de ruggengraat is van een succesvolle technologie-strategie, en ons team is toegewijd aan het creëren van oplossingen die niet alleen voldoen aan uw huidige eisen, maar ook anticiperen op toekomstige behoeften.

Een systeem zonder duidelijke architectuur is gedoemd om een legacy-systeem te worden naarmate de eisen in de loop van de tijd veranderen. Om dit tegen te gaan, passen we de inzichtelijke 'IDesign-methode' toe, die helpt bij het creëren van een solide architectuur die de tand des tijds doorstaat. Deze methode is ontworpen om de veelvoorkomende valkuilen van slechte architectuur te voorkomen, zoals verhoogde onderhoudskosten, verminderde systeemprestaties en het onvermogen om efficiënt op te schalen. Door ons te richten op het creëren van een robuuste en flexibele architectonische basis, zorgen we ervoor dat uw systeem zich kan aanpassen aan veranderende bedrijfsbehoeften en technologische vooruitgang.

Het Belang van Goede Architectuur

Veel projecten beginnen klein en beheersbaar, maar naarmate de eisen evolueren, worden ze vaak complex en moeilijk te onderhouden. Zonder een solide architectuur kunnen deze projecten snel veranderen in legacy-systemen. Onze aanpak zorgt ervoor dat uw architectuur duidelijke richtlijnen biedt voor nieuwe functies en onderhoud. Goede architectuur vereenvoudigt niet alleen het ontwikkelingsproces, maar verbetert ook het vermogen van het systeem om naadloos nieuwe technologieën en functionaliteiten te integreren. Door te investeren in een sterk architecturaal raamwerk, kunt u technische schulden vermijden die vaak slecht ontworpen systemen teisteren, en ervoor zorgen dat uw technologische infrastructuur wendbaar en responsief blijft.

De IDesign-methode

De IDesign-methode, ontwikkeld door Juval Löwy, een legende in Microsoft-software, is een gestructureerde aanpak voor het bouwen en volgen van softwarearchitectuur. Het benadrukt het creëren van een systeem dat zich kan aanpassen aan veranderende eisen zonder het ontwerp te breken. Deze methode pleit voor een gedisciplineerde benadering van systeemontwerp, waarbij de architectuur wordt behandeld als een levend wezen dat evolueert met het bedrijf. Door te focussen op kerngebruiksscenario's en het identificeren van gebieden met volatiliteit, zorgt de IDesign-methode ervoor dat de architectuur robuust en veerkrachtig blijft, in staat om zowel huidige als toekomstige uitdagingen het hoofd te bieden.

Kernprincipes van de IDesign-methode

Onze systeemontwerpdiensten omvatten de volgende kernprincipes van de IDesign-methode:

Uitgebreide Analyse

We voeren grondige analyses uit om uw huidige systeemmogelijkheden te begrijpen en gebieden voor verbetering te identificeren. Dit omvat gedetailleerde beoordelingen van de infrastructuur, het identificeren van knelpunten en het voorstellen van verbeteringen om optimale prestaties te garanderen. Onze holistische aanpak bestrijkt hardware-, software- en netwerkcomponenten om een efficiënter, betrouwbaarder en schaalbaarder systeem te creëren dat voldoet aan uw huidige en toekomstige zakelijke behoeften.

Op Maat Gemaakte Oplossingen

Onze oplossingen zijn op maat gemaakt om aan uw specifieke behoeften te voldoen, wat zorgt voor maximale efficiëntie en effectiviteit. We werken nauw met u samen om een systeemarchitectuur te ontwikkelen die aansluit bij uw bedrijfsdoelen en technische vereisten, en bieden een flexibel en schaalbaar raamwerk. Onze gepersonaliseerde benadering behandelt unieke uitdagingen en benut bestaande middelen, waardoor het systeem effectief en duurzaam blijft op de lange termijn.

Volatiliteitsgebaseerde Decompositie

De IDesign-methode benadrukt Volatiliteitsgebaseerde Decompositie, waarbij we gebieden in uw systeem identificeren die waarschijnlijk zullen veranderen en deze inkapselen in specifieke diensten. Dit zorgt ervoor dat wijzigingen in requirements niet het hele systeem verstoren, waardoor stabiliteit en schaalbaarheid behouden blijven. Door volatiele elementen te isoleren, creëren we een veerkrachtige architectuur die veranderingen kan opvangen zonder grote aanpassingen. Deze aanpak beperkt risico's en zorgt voor een robuuste, aanpasbare architectuur die meegroeit met uw bedrijf en technologische ontwikkelingen. Het helpt ook bij het beheren van complexiteit door het systeem op te delen in beheersbare componenten die onafhankelijk kunnen worden bijgewerkt of vervangen.

Services en Communicatie

De IDesign-methode categoriseert services in vijf typen: Client, Manager, Engine, Resource Access en Utility. Deze indeling definieert duidelijke verantwoordelijkheden voor elke service en reguleert hun onderlinge communicatie, wat resulteert in verminderde complexiteit en losse koppeling. Deze gestructureerde benadering bevordert efficiënter projectmanagement, heldere taakverdeling en vereenvoudigde probleemoplossing. Elk service type vervult een specifieke functie binnen het systeem:

  • Client: Beheert de communicatie met clients, zonder enige bedrijfslogica, wat zorgt voor een duidelijke scheiding van verantwoordelijkheden.
  • Manager: Orkestreert bedrijfsgebruiksscenario's, definieert workflows en beheert het algemene systeemgedrag.
  • Engine: Voert bedrijfslogica uit en implementeert de kernfunctionaliteiten die het systeem vereist.
  • Resource Access: Beheert de toegang tot bronnen zoals databases of externe diensten, waarbij de gegevensaccesslogica wordt ingekapseld.
  • Utility: Biedt overkoepelende zorgen zoals logging, authenticatie en andere herbruikbare componenten.

Onze systeemontwerpdiensten bij Rutron B.V. omvatten alles, van initieel advies en planning tot implementatie en voortdurende ondersteuning. We zorgen ervoor dat elk aspect van uw systeem met precisie en zorg is ontworpen, van hardware- en softwareselectie tot netwerkarchitectuur en gegevensbeheer. Onze toewijding aan uitmuntendheid betekent dat we voortdurend streven naar het verbeteren van onze methodologieën en op de hoogte blijven van de nieuwste technologische ontwikkelingen, zodat we de best mogelijke oplossingen aan onze klanten kunnen leveren. Ons doel is om u te voorzien van een systeem dat niet alleen aan uw huidige behoeften voldoet, maar ook uw toekomstige groei en innovatie ondersteunt.

De hoge faalpercentages van IT-projecten zijn een aanhoudend probleem, waarbij recente gegevens aantonen dat 66% van de technologieprojecten eindigt in gedeeltelijk of volledig falen. Grote projecten zijn bijzonder kwetsbaar, waarbij minder dan 10% succes behaalt. Deze mislukkingen zijn vaak het gevolg van een gebrek aan duidelijke architectuur en slechte projectmanagementpraktijken.

Volgens het CHAOS 2020-rapport van de Standish Group eindigt 66% van de technologieprojecten (gebaseerd op de analyse van 50.000 projecten wereldwijd) in gedeeltelijk of volledig falen. Grotere projecten hebben meer kans om uitdagingen tegen te komen of volledig te falen, met grote projecten die minder dan 10% van de tijd succesvol zijn. Hetzelfde rapport vond dat 31% van de Amerikaanse IT-projecten volledig werd geannuleerd en dat de prestaties van 53% zo zorgwekkend waren dat ze werden uitgedaagd. Onderzoek van McKinsey in 2020 vond dat 17% van de grote IT-projecten zo slecht presteert dat ze het voortbestaan van het bedrijf bedreigen. Daarnaast schatte BCG (2020) dat 70% van de digitale transformatie-inspanningen hun doelen niet bereiken. Een CISQ-rapport uit 2020 schatte dat de totale kosten van onsuccesvolle ontwikkelingsprojecten onder Amerikaanse bedrijven $ 260 miljard bedragen, terwijl de totale kosten van operationele storingen veroorzaakt door slechte kwaliteit software naar schatting $ 1,56 biljoen bedragen.

De redenen voor deze mislukkingen zijn veelzijdig en komen vaak voort uit problemen met betrekking tot mensen en mensensystemen. Veelvoorkomende problemen zijn onder meer een gebrek aan duidelijke projectomvang en doelstellingen, te optimistische planning en ontoereikend projectmanagement. Bovendien blijven de gebruikersvereisten vaak onduidelijk en is er een gebrek aan discipline en emotionele intelligentie onder technologen. Om deze problemen aan te pakken, is het cruciaal om aan het begin van een project de juiste vragen te stellen, ervoor te zorgen dat gebruikers voortdurend betrokken blijven en duidelijke en nauwkeurige vereisten te handhaven.

Ons ervaren team is toegewijd aan het leveren van uitzonderlijke systeemontwerpdiensten die niet alleen aan uw verwachtingen voldoen, maar deze overtreffen. Vertrouw op Rutron B.V. als uw partner in het bereiken van technologische uitmuntendheid en het bevorderen van uw bedrijf. Wij geloven dat ons succes wordt gemeten aan uw succes, en we zijn vastbesloten om u te helpen bij het opbouwen van een robuuste, schaalbare en toekomstbestendige technologische infrastructuur die uw bedrijfsdoelen en -groei ondersteunt.

Klaar om van uw IT-project een succesverhaal te maken?

Ons team van experts staat klaar om op maat gemaakte oplossingen te bieden die zijn afgestemd op uw behoeften. Neem nu contact met ons op om uw GRATIS eerste consultatie te plannen en ontdek hoe wij uw bedrijf kunnen ondersteunen.

Callback Shape